Here's the strategy for one of the hardest battles, if not the hardest battle for this whole Backyard Arena. There are many different ways to do this, but I'll give you my strategy and I hope it helps some of you.

-----

Battle: Master Ring User
Class: Super Heavy
Enemies: Veteran Soldier, Subel the Hound
Conditions: No items, skills, or spells allowed, Kaim required, defeat Veteran Soldier (2 Stars)
Secret Condition: Defeat Subel the Hound first (3 Stars)

3 Star Strategy:

- You only have the attack/defend option here, so prepare ahead of time! Use your best weapons, rings, and accessories. Fill your immortals skill slots with skills such as: Absorb Attack, Persistance, Attack Boost, Defense Boost, Ailement Resistance, Shield, Barricadus, Complete Defense, Crisis Attack/Defense Boost, Guard Heal, etc. Absorb Attack and Persistance at the very least will save your ass.

- To get three stars, you must defeat the Master's dog first. Put on any ring that will give Toxin lv. 3 effect, and get a perfect on Subel the Hound. The dog will die within 4 turns.

- While you wait for the hound to die, avoid getting off too many attacks off. Defend with a few members, and use one member to try and keep getting commands right. If you get the command wrong, Subel takes off a whopping 15,000 damage. Not pretty. If you don't attack at all, he's going to sick the dog on you anyways.

- If you get enough successful commands, the Ring Master will forfeit and you win the match regardless of how much HP him and Subel have left. This will make it so you'll win the battle with 2 stars, but not get the secret condition.

- If you're unsuccessful too many times, the Ring Master will use Annihilation to wipe out your entire party before you have the chance to finish the battle. You need to balance the commands correctly so you don't get too many wrong, but you also don't get too many correct.

- Try to damage the Ring Master as much as you can before Subel dies so you can get a head start. As soon as Subel bites the dust, the Ring Master really ups the anti. He'll use Coverus, Shieldus, Powerus, Healus, and Speedus as buffs/healing. Additionally, he'll use Prismus, Fear, and his regular physical attacks to hurt your party.

- At this point, you won't have to worry about him commanding you to hit certain rings. You will just have to give him everything you've got! You won't be able to poison him or anything, so switch rings. Rings that will allow you to absorb HP are a huge help, and any additional damage perks will help you along as well.

- At this point, it's a matter of luck. Seth and Kaim (and other immortals) may be able to absorb attack/magic.. and that's what you're really counting on to save your ass. Persistance will also let you hang in for one time, and hopefully you can gain some HP back for the next turn. Once mortals are gone, they're gone for good. Immortals will be revived in 2 turns automatically.

- Every time you attack him, he will counter.. so keep in mind that it will feel that he's getting several turns because of this.

- Once he's low on HP he'll start to use Healus on himself, so use this to your advantage, because he'll waste his turns. Other then that, he doesn't have a specific pattern.
